Venue Spaces and Capacity
The Conservatory offers multiple event spaces designed to accommodate different group sizes and celebration styles. The main conservatory structure provides a covered indoor-outdoor setting with floor-to-ceiling glass panels that frame the surrounding Franschhoek landscape. The property includes dedicated areas for ceremonies, receptions, and pre-event gatherings. Guests can move between indoor spaces and outdoor terraces, with the venue accommodating intimate gatherings of 30 guests through to larger celebrations of up to 120 seated guests. The flexible layout allows event hosts to configure spaces according to their specific requirements, whether for a corporate seminar, product launch, or multi-day wedding celebration.

Location and Franschhoek Setting
Klein Kastaiing sits along Happy Valley Road, one of Franschhoek’s quieter routes that provides easy access while maintaining a secluded atmosphere. The venue is positioned approximately 75 kilometers from Cape Town International Airport, making it accessible for destination events while feeling removed from urban activity. Franschhoek itself is known for its concentration of wine estates, gourmet restaurants, and mountain scenery, giving event guests ample options for extending their visit. The surrounding valley provides dramatic visual backdrops in every direction, with the Franschhoek Mountains rising to the south and vineyard-covered slopes visible from the venue’s terraces. Many couples and corporate groups build multi-day experiences around their event at The Conservatory, coordinating wine tastings, valley tours, and accommodation at nearby guesthouses and hotels.

Seasonal Considerations and Booking
Franschhoek’s event season peaks during the South African summer months from October through April, when warm weather and long daylight hours make outdoor components of events most enjoyable. The Conservatory’s enclosed spaces provide flexibility for events scheduled during the cooler and wetter winter months from May through September, when the venue’s heating and covered areas become essential. Advance booking is recommended particularly for Saturday weddings during the peak season, with many couples securing their date 12 to 18 months ahead. Corporate clients often find greater availability for weekday events and can sometimes arrange last-minute bookings during quieter periods.
